Top Strategies to Harness LinkedIn for Real Estate Developers

Leverage LinkedIn for Real Estate Developers

LinkedIn is a business social media platform whose primary goal is professional profile promotion or company marketing. It differs from other platforms, like Facebook and Instagram, as it serves a business and professional purpose. A strong LinkedIn profile with a professional photo, customized URL, and engaging summary is essential for real estate developers to attract ideal clients and effectively utilize LinkedIn marketing. Networking with industry professionals and participating in LinkedIn groups fosters valuable connections and insights and establishes credibility in the real estate sector.

This article covers the key strategies: creating a strong profile, networking, joining groups, promoting projects, and generating leads.

Building a Strong LinkedIn Profile for Developers

A well-crafted profile not only attracts potential clients but also helps in building valuable LinkedIn connections.

#1 First Impressions Matter

First impressions matter, and on LinkedIn, your profile is your digital handshake. Start with a professional profile photo that establishes trust and credibility. Complement this with an effective cover image that conveys important messages or calls to action to your right audience. These visual elements are the foundation of a standout LinkedIn profile that attracts valuable LinkedIn connections and boosts LinkedIn engagement.

#2 Customize Your LinkedIn URL

Next, customize your LinkedIn URL to make your profile more accessible and memorable. Your LinkedIn headline is your elevator pitch. It should summarize your key skills and attract potential clients. Remember, prospective clients are more interested in your accomplishments than your job history, so highlight specific sales figures and relevant skills to impress them.

#3 Vital Summary Section

The LinkedIn summary section is vital for engaging prospects right away. Pose questions that attract interest, create content, and list any industry-related awards and certifications to enhance your credibility. Building a robust first-degree network will maximize your visibility and content reach. With these elements in place, your LinkedIn profile will be a powerful tool in your professional arsenal.

Networking with Industry Professionals

Networking is the lifeblood of commercial real estate development, and building a strong LinkedIn network is essential. It helps you gain valuable insights into the local market, including potential property listings. Generating referrals and repeat business relies on building and maintaining connections with real estate agents and real estate investors. Access to essential resources such as contractors and legal advisors comes from a strong professional network to sell properties.

#1 Attend Industry Events

Attending industry events, including LinkedIn events, allows you to meet potential collaborators and expand your network. Following up with new contacts reinforces connections and demonstrates your interest in collaboration. Sharing insights on industry research and public policy can position you as a knowledgeable resource in the real estate field.

#2 Share Engaging Content

Finally, offer value to your connections by sharing engaging LinkedIn content, including local news, community events, and future project renderings. This not only fosters interaction on your profile but also enhances your networking opportunities. Remember, networking is not just about collecting contacts. It’s about building meaningful relationships that can propel your business forward.

Joining Relevant LinkedIn Groups for Real Estate Agents and Real Estate Investors

LinkedIn groups are a goldmine for networking and industry insights. These groups consist of incredibly targeted subsets of professionals relevant to real estate development and investment. Participating in these groups helps grow your network, generate leads, and effectively address the needs of your target audience.

Engaging with LinkedIn groups enhances your visibility and establishes your expertise in the real estate sector. LinkedIn allows users to join groups where they can directly communicate with members, an advantage often restricted on other social media platforms. However, authenticity is key – avoid spamming and be genuine in your interactions.

To maximize engagement, follow the specific rules of each LinkedIn group. Daily live events and newsletters can help build a community and reinforce your online presence within these groups. By joining and actively participating in relevant LinkedIn groups, you position yourself as a key player in the LinkedIn community.

Leveraging LinkedIn Articles for Thought Leadership

Establishing authority in real estate through LinkedIn publishing can showcase your expertise and engage your audience. Focus on a particular niche within real estate, like luxury or sustainable properties, to enhance your visibility and influence. Educational posts about industry trends and skills can position you as a knowledgeable resource.

Consistent posting keeps you in your audience’s awareness, making you a reliable presence on LinkedIn. Share client testimonials to build trust and credibility, showcasing a proven track record in real estate transactions. Market statistics and updates provide valuable insights that can influence potential clients’ buying or selling decisions.

Create and share useful content that demonstrates your knowledge and provides value. This could include templates, guides, or behind-the-scenes content offering a personal glimpse into the daily life of real estate agents. Leveraging LinkedIn articles helps establish yourself as a thought leader and build a loyal following.

Utilizing LinkedIn Premium for Enhanced Networking

LinkedIn Premium offers several features that can significantly enhance your networking efforts. InMails from LinkedIn Premium can be sent to individuals outside your current connections, expanding your outreach possibilities. These InMails have a higher effectiveness rate compared to traditional emails.

The advanced search and messaging tools facilitate direct engagement with affluent clients. The unlimited search feature allows you to explore potential leads and partners without limitations. Additionally, LinkedIn Premium provides access to a database showing who viewed your profile, aiding in lead identification.

Identifying and following up with leads who have viewed your profile boosts your lead generation efforts. LinkedIn Premium significantly enhances your ability to connect with potential clients and grow your professional network, especially when combined with LinkedIn Sales Navigator.

Promoting Real Estate Projects Through Sponsored Posts

Sponsored posts on LinkedIn, a key component of LinkedIn advertising, can enhance visibility by promoting content that has already received positive engagement organically. Using videos in sponsored posts can further enhance engagement, providing a dynamic view of properties for potential buyers.

LinkedIn analytics can be used to track the performance of sponsored posts, allowing for strategy adjustments based on audience response. Leveraging sponsored posts allows real estate developers to effectively promote their projects and reach a wider audience.

Engaging with LinkedIn News Feed

Engaging with the LinkedIn news feed is essential for maintaining visibility and staying connected with your network, thereby boosting LinkedIn engagement. Write posts relating trending topics to real estate to capture audience interest. Interactive features like polls and Q&A sessions engage audiences and facilitate valuable feedback about their real estate preferences.

Seasonal and holiday-themed posts can keep content relevant and resonate with the interests of the audience throughout the year. Engage with your network by sharing and liking posts, as well as congratulating connections on milestones.

Prioritize quality over quantity in your posts to achieve higher engagement and visibility within the LinkedIn community.

Creating and Sharing Visual Content like 3D Renderings

Visual content is a powerful tool for attracting attention and is highly shareable, making it essential for real estate professionals. 3D renderings of real estate developments, eye-catching infographics, and LinkedIn video content can help real estate agents stand out on LinkedIn.

Using virtual property tours can provide an immersive experience, showcasing key features of homes through high-quality motion presentation. Before-and-after posts effectively illustrate property transformations, demonstrating expertise in renovations and enhancements. Utilize tools like Canva to create attractive infographics that visually convey complex information.

Sharing unbuilt 3D renderings on LinkedIn is a strategic way for real estate developers to showcase their vision and creativity before a project breaks ground. These visualizations offer a glimpse into future developments, helping investors, clients, and stakeholders see the potential of a property long before construction begins. Unbuilt renderings demonstrate a developer’s ability to plan and execute innovative designs, making them a powerful tool for gaining interest and support. By highlighting these projects, developers can build excitement, secure pre-sales or investments, and establish themselves as forward-thinking leaders in the real estate industry.

Generating Leads through LinkedIn Messaging Ads

LinkedIn messaging ads are a valuable tool for LinkedIn lead generation, allowing real estate developers to connect directly with potential clients and investors through LinkedIn work. LinkedIn outperforms Facebook and Twitter with a lead conversion rate of 277%.

LinkedIn offers various advertising options for engaging target audiences, including messaging ads and text ads. Leveraging these advertising options helps real estate developers generate more leads and stay updated on their marketing strategy and market trends.

Real Estate Agent and Investor Outreach

As a real estate agent, leveraging LinkedIn to connect with potential clients, including real estate investors, is essential for expanding your professional network and generating more leads. Here are some effective strategies to enhance your outreach:

  • Identify and Connect: Start by identifying and connecting with real estate investors, property managers, and other industry professionals within your network. This can be done by searching for relevant keywords and joining industry-specific LinkedIn groups.
  • Join Relevant Groups: Participate in LinkedIn groups related to real estate investing, property management, and commercial real estate. These groups are excellent platforms for expanding your reach and engaging with like-minded professionals.
  • Share Valuable Content: Establish yourself as a thought leader by sharing valuable content such as market trends, investment opportunities, and industry insights. Regularly posting informative LinkedIn articles can help you stay top-of-mind with your connections.
  • Utilize Messaging Features: Use LinkedIn’s messaging feature to reach out to potential clients and investors. Personalized messages can help you start meaningful conversations and build lasting relationships.
  • Leverage Sales Navigator: Consider using LinkedIn Sales Navigator to find and connect with potential clients and investors. This premium feature offers advanced search capabilities and insights that can enhance your outreach efforts.

By building strong relationships with real estate investors and other industry professionals, you can increase your chances of generating more leads and closing deals. Consistent engagement and valuable content sharing are key to successful outreach on LinkedIn.

Generating Organic Visibility on LinkedIn

Generating organic visibility on LinkedIn is crucial for real estate developers looking to expand their reach without relying solely on paid advertising. Here are some strategies to enhance your organic presence on the platform:

  1. Optimize Your Profile: Ensure your LinkedIn profile is complete and optimized with relevant keywords. A well-crafted profile with a professional photo, compelling headline, and detailed summary can attract more views and connections.
  2. Consistent Posting: Regularly share valuable content that resonates with your target audience. This could include industry news, market trends, project updates, and educational articles. Consistency helps keep you top-of-mind with your connections.
  3. Engage with Your Network: Actively engage with your connections by liking, commenting, and sharing their posts. This not only strengthens your relationships but also increases your visibility on their networks.
  4. Leverage Hashtags: Use relevant hashtags to increase the discoverability of your posts. Hashtags help categorize your content and make it easier for users interested in those topics to find your posts.
  5. Join and Participate in Groups: Engage in LinkedIn groups related to real estate development and investment. Sharing insights and participating in discussions can position you as an industry expert and expand your network.

By implementing these strategies, you can enhance your organic visibility on LinkedIn, attract more leads, and grow your professional network.

Measuring Success and Optimization

To ensure your LinkedIn marketing strategy is effective, tracking metrics and continuously optimizing your approach is crucial. Here are some tips to help you measure success and refine your strategy:

  • Track Engagement Metrics: Monitor likes, comments, and shares to gauge how your content is performing. High engagement indicates that your posts resonate with your audience.
  • Analyze Page Views: Use LinkedIn’s analytics tools to see how many people are viewing your content and which types of posts are performing best. This data from LinkedIn analytics can help you tailor your content to better meet the interests of your target audience.
  • Monitor Paid Ads Performance: If you pay LinkedIn for sponsored content or ads, use LinkedIn’s built-in analytics tools to track their performance. This will help you understand the return on investment and make necessary adjustments.
  • Set Up Conversion Tracking: Measure the number of leads generated from your LinkedIn marketing efforts by setting up conversion tracking. This will provide insights into which strategies are most effective in driving conversions.
  • Conduct A/B Testing: Experiment with different content, headlines, and call-to-action through A/B testing. This will help you determine what works best for your target audience and optimize your content accordingly.

By consistently tracking key metrics and optimizing your approach, you can refine your LinkedIn marketing strategy and achieve better results. This ongoing process of measurement and adjustment is essential for long-term success on LinkedIn.

Consistent Engagement for Long-Term Success

Consistent LinkedIn engagement is crucial for maintaining a presence on LinkedIn and staying connected with your audience. Regularly posting relevant content alongside sponsored posts can help maintain audience interest and improve brand visibility.

Being authentic and vulnerable in posts can foster deeper connections with your audience. Sharing insights into your daily life in real estate can attract those considering similar careers. By maintaining consistency, you can ensure long-term success on LinkedIn.
